Schweitzer slams Rattlers
After errors by reliever Andrew Fiorenza (0-1) and shortstop Ogui Diaz gave the Swing (31-24) a 4-2 lead, Schweitzer drilled a one-out blast, his fourth, over the left-field wall to cap the scoring.
Quad Cities starter Eddie Degerman retired the first 13 batters before yielding two runs on one hit and two walks with eight strikeouts over five innings. Shaun Garceau (4-2) allowed two hits and fanned a career-high nine over the final four frames to pick up the win.
Alex Liddi drilled a two-run homer, his fifth, in the fifth for the Timber Rattlers (17-37).
Brandon Buckman stroked an RBI single and Christian Reyes lifted a sacrifice fly in the eighth to knot the score as Quad Cities came from behind for its fourth straight win.
Fiorenza surrendered five unearned runs on three hits with a walk and a strikeout in 1 2/3 innings. Timber Rattlers starter Nathan Adcock gave up two runs on seven hits and three walks with five strikeouts in 7 1/3 frames. --Marissa Rega/MLB.com
